Kasaragod Private Bus Crew Accused of Discriminating Against Women Passengers

Kasaragod: A complaint was filed against the crew of a private bus in Kasaragod after women passengers allegedly were prevented from boarding the bus when their KSRTC bus broke down at Kanathur. According to the complaint, the crew allegedly said that only male passengers would be allowed to board. The complainant alleged gender discrimination and unsafe boarding practices and sought action from the transport authorities.
